Below are the most popular names of boys from the 1900s (1900-1909) and the 2000s (2000-2008 ytd).
Rank
1900s
2000s
1
John
Jacob
2
William
Michael
3
James
Joshua
4
George
Matthew
5
Charles
Andrew
6
Robert
Christopher
7
Joseph
Joseph
8
Frank
Daniel
9
Edward
Nicholas
10
Thomas
Ethan
Note, Joseph is the only boy's name that ranked in the top 10 for both decades although it was absent from the top 10 from 1940-1979. I would have expected to see more of ...
